POTATO CHIP BARK RECIPE - (4.6/5)
Provided by msippigrl
Number Of Ingredients 3
Steps:
- Line a baking sheet with parchment paper; set aside. Melt milk chocolate chips as directed on package, being careful not to scorch them. Pour melted chocolate out on the parchment paper and spread out to about a 1/4" thickness. Immediately, sprinkle the crumbled potato chips over the top. Place in the freezer to harden, 15-20 minutes. Drizzle melted white chocolate over the top of the potato chips. (I cut a tiny corner off a plastic ziptop bag.) Return to freezer for another 20 minutes, or until hardened. Break or snap into irregular pieces; place on a serving plate and serve.
HEALTHY BAKED POTATO CHIP FISH
Baked walleye, perch, pike, cod or haddock breaded with crispy low-fat potato chips and baked to yummy perfection! So good and good for you!
Provided by KadesMom
Categories < 30 Mins
Time 30m
Yield 4 serving(s)
Number Of Ingredients 9
Steps:
- Cut fish into serving-size pieces.
- Place milk in a shallow bowl.
- In another shallow bowl, combine potato chips, parmesan cheese, thyme, garlic powder, pepper.
- Dip fish in milk, then with the potato chip mixture.
- Sprinkle a greased 8-inch square baking dish with crumbs; drizzle with butter.
- Bake uncovered at 500 degrees for 12-14 minutes or until fish flakes easily with a fork.

POTATO CHIP CANDY
Make and share this Potato Chip Candy recipe from Food.com.
Provided by Moe Larry Cheese
Categories Candy
Time 15m
Yield 24 candies, 6 serving(s)
Number Of Ingredients 4
Steps:
- 1.Coat cookie sheet with 1 Tbs. butter.
- 2.In a 2 quart dish, microwave almond bark until melted.
- 3.Mix in chips and stir gently until all chips are coated.
- 4.Add nuts and stir gently.
- 5.Pour onto buttered cookie sheet and spread evenly.
- 6.Refrigerate until firm.
- 7.Cut into pieces and store in a cool dry place.

POTATO CHIP CHICKEN
Boneless chicken breasts marinated overnight, then baked in onion-flavored potato chips. Serve with twice-baked potatoes, if desired.
Provided by Larry
Categories Meat and Poultry Recipes Chicken Chicken Breast Recipes Breaded
Time P1DT1h
Yield 4
Number Of Ingredients 5
Steps:
- To Marinate: Put chicken breasts in a nonporous glass dish or bowl. Drizzle melted butter or margarine over chicken and season with salt and ground black pepper. Cover dish and refrigerate overnight.
- Preheat oven to 375 degrees F (190 degrees C).
- Put potato chip crumbs in a shallow dish or bowl. Roll chicken in crumbs until well coated, then place in a lightly greased 9x13 inch baking dish.
- Bake at 375 degrees F (190 degrees C) for 45 minutes or until chicken juices run clear.
